Apple is finally doing something to help their customers by letting them trade in their broke iPhones. Apple currently only has an iPhone trade-in program for phones that are still in good shape, but they are going to start changing their policies to allow trade-ins for damaged iPhones “within reason.” This new policy will be allow users to upgrade their phone instead of paying for screen repairs.
